Kinigi, nestled at the foothills of the majestic Virunga Mountains, is more than just a gateway to gorilla trekking; it's a vibrant sanctuary for a remarkable diversity of bird species. These lush landscapes, encompassing volcanic slopes, montane forests, and savanna-like clearings, provide critical habitats for both endemic and migratory birds, making it a prime destination for birdwatching enthusiasts. What to Expect on Birdwatching Excursions Tours in Kinigi

Duration

Most birdwatching excursions in Kinigi range from 3 to 5 hours. Some specialized tours might extend to a full day.

Weather

Kinigi experiences a tropical climate with frequent rain, especially in the afternoons. Mornings are often clearer and are ideal for birding. Expect cool to mild temperatures due to the elevation.

Group Size

Tours typically operate with small groups, ranging from 2 to 8 participants, to minimize disturbance to wildlife and enhance the viewing experience.

What's Included

Usually includes the services of a local birding guide, park entry fees if applicable, and sometimes bottled water. Specific inclusions vary by operator.

Meeting Point

Meeting points are generally at your accommodation in Kinigi, a central meeting point in the town, or at the entrance to Volcanoes National Park.

Costs

Prices can vary based on duration, group size, and inclusions, generally starting from around $45 USD per person.

Expert Tips for the Best Experience

1

Wake up early; most bird activity occurs during the cooler morning hours.

2

Dress in neutral, earth-toned clothing to blend in with the environment.

3

Wear sturdy, comfortable walking shoes or hiking boots.

4

Bring insect repellent, especially for wooded areas.

5

A good pair of binoculars is essential for spotting and identifying birds.

6

Carry a field guide for Rwandan birds or use a bird identification app.

7

Be patient and quiet; birdwatching requires observation and stillness.

8

Stay hydrated and bring snacks, especially for longer excursions.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q:What is the best time of year for birdwatching in Kinigi?

A: The drier months, from June to September and December to February, are generally considered the best for birdwatching in Kinigi, as birds are often more concentrated around water sources and visibility is better. However, birdlife is present year-round.

Q:Do I need to be an experienced birder to join a tour?

A: Not at all. These tours are suitable for all levels, from absolute beginners to seasoned birdwatchers. Guides are adept at helping everyone identify birds.

Q:What kind of birds can I expect to see?

A: You can expect to see a wide variety, including various species of sunbirds, turacos, hornbills, kingfishers, and numerous forest birds endemic to the Albertine Rift. Eagles and other raptors are also commonly sighted.

Q:Are cameras and photography allowed?

A: Yes, photography is generally encouraged. However, it's important to use lenses that don't require flash, as it can disturb the birds. Be mindful of your movements while taking photos.

Q:What should I wear on a birdwatching tour?

A: Lightweight, long-sleeved clothing in muted colors is recommended to protect against the sun, insects, and vegetation. Comfortable hiking shoes are a must, and bring a waterproof jacket as rain is common.

Q:How far do these tours typically walk?

A: The walking distance varies. Forest treks can involve several kilometers on uneven terrain, while other excursions might be much shorter, with more stationary observation points.

Q:Is it possible to see gorillas and birds on the same trip?

A: Absolutely. Many visitors combine a gorilla trekking permit with a birdwatching excursion. Birding tours often take place on days before or after gorilla treks.

Q:What happens if it rains during the tour?

A: Rain is common in the region. Guides are experienced in continuing tours during light rain, often finding sheltered spots. If the weather becomes severe, the guide will assess the situation and may decide to shorten or reschedule the tour for safety.

Best Time to Visit

Weather

Kinigi experiences a tropical highland climate with relatively stable temperatures year-round. Expect cool mornings and evenings, with daytime temperatures being pleasant. Rainfall is common throughout the year, often occurring in short, intense bursts, particularly in the afternoons. The region is characterized by its lush, verdant landscape due to consistent precipitation.

Best Months

The drier months, generally from June to September and December to February, are considered the best times to visit Kinigi for gorilla trekking, offering clearer trails and less rain.

Peak Season

Peak season typically aligns with the dry periods (June-September and December-February), seeing the highest number of visitors due to favorable trekking conditions.

Off Season

The wetter months (March-May and October-November) constitute the off-season, with fewer crowds, potentially lower lodge prices, and incredibly lush scenery, though trekking can be more challenging.

Transportation Tips

Getting around Kinigi is best facilitated by pre-arranged transport, often through your lodge or a local tour operator. While walking is possible within the immediate village, venturing to trailheads or surrounding attractions requires a 4x4 vehicle due to the rough terrain. Taxis are scarce, so relying on your driver for excursions is common. Negotiate prices beforehand for any extended trips. For a more immersive experience, consider hiring a local guide who can navigate and share insights as you explore.
